New Gear

I have a new full frame camera and lens. It's a Nikon D700 (£1,800) and a 24mm-70mm F2.8 Zoom Lens (£1,200). Expensive, but the results I'm getting with this new gear is proving well worth while. I still shoot with my Nikon D90 as a back-up camera and it is still useful at weddings as I can have a different size lens on each camera or different settings. I have taken photos with it for a Photographer of the Year competition. I will let you know how I get on.

Pet Lifestyle Photography

I'm now a member of the SWPP (Society of Wedding and Portrait Photographers) and have just spent 3 days at SWPP convention in London. Mind blowing. What a fantastic venue. (And what fantastic prices for a glass of wine!!!)

Anyhow, having spent 3 days in various Masterclasses and visiting the trade stands, I have gained so much in knowledge of various aspects of the photographic industry and spent a few hundred more pounds too.

After one particularly inspiring Masterclass by Lesley Wood, I've decided to make pet portraiture a major part of my business focus.  I've always loved taking pictures of animals; so what better business plan could there be? (Rhetorical question).

So, I will be offering a full days fun pet photography experience and produce large framed images, photobooks and canvasses for my clients. But it's not just about getting a decent photograph of your pet, it's about having a fantastic, fun experience, with the memories and souvenirs to remember what a great day you've had. Of course, sadly, every pet owner knows that their pet won't be around forever, but if you've got some fantastic lifestyle prints, your memories will stay with you for life.

On the 8th November I put myself on a 4 day Wedding Photography course with 'The Trained Eye'. What an amazing course it was. Not only do I now have a stylish portfolio, but it has helped me to develop a whole new style of shooting. I can't wait to try it out at my next wedding assignment.

As a result of the training, I have now added a new lens to my arsenal to help me capture the soft light images that look so perfect in a wedding album. Take a look at the short video of my wedding portfolio below and I'm sure you will see what I mean.


With the changing styles of wedding photography, it is important to keep up to date with the latest trends from around the world. The reportage style, which seems to have come over from America, gives the photographer a whole new raft of opportunities to capture exciting and sentimental images for the wedding photobook. Add to that a contemporary style of shooting which, is now gaining popularity, and your memories from the day will be captured forever in a whole new way.
